Habitat Health empowers older adults to experience more good days in their homes and communities. Through the Program of All-Inclusive Care for the Elderly (PACE), we provide comprehensive medical care along with support for daily needs such as meals, transportation, and in ‑ home assistance. We deliver coordinated clinical and social care in our centers and directly in participants’ homes, creating a fully integrated experience that brings peace of mind and a true sense of belonging. As we expand our scalable, affordable PACE model to meet the growing and complex needs of aging populations, our mission ‑ driven care teams continue to help participants live well on their own terms.
Habitat Health is supported by leading healthcare organizations and investors including New Enterprise Associates, Kaiser Permanente, and Town Hall Ventures. Role Scope :
We are hiring a Senior Manager, Strategic Technology Applications to help build and operate the technology application layer across Habitat Health’s growing PACE organization. This is a high-impact, cross-functional role sitting within the Strategic Technology Applications team, reporting directly to the Director of Strategic Technology Applications.
As Habitat Health expands into new markets and scales its center operations, the Strategic Technology Applications team is responsible for the selection, implementation, training, and ongoing management of the technology systems that enable clinical, operational, growth, and administrative workflows. This role will serve as a key operational and strategic partner, owning a portfolio of applications across multiple domains—include call, clinical, core operations, growth, and risk adjustment systems.
The ideal candidate is a systems-minded, detail-oriented healthcare technology leader who is comfortable navigating vendor relationships, configuring and optimizing software platforms, and partnering with clinical and operational stakeholders to drive adoption and impact.
Responsibilities include:
Application Ownership & Operations
Serve as the primary owner and subject matter expert for a portfolio of strategic technology applications, beginning with call/communications platforms (TalkDesk) and expanding to additional systems over time
Manage end-to-end application lifecycle: vendor relationship management, configuration, access provisioning, issue resolution, upgrades, and roadmap planning
Monitor system performance, proactively identify gaps or friction points, and drive resolution in partnership with vendors and internal stakeholders
Maintain documentation for all owned systems, including configuration guides, workflow SOPs, and user support materials
Ensure applications are properly integrated with adjacent systems (e.g., Epic, Salesforce, ancillary clinical tools) and support data integrity across platforms
Implementation & New Center Expansion
Lead or co-lead technology application implementations for new PACE centers, including system configuration, workflow validation, user acceptance testing, and go-live support
Develop and execute application readiness plans aligned to center launch timelines
Coordinate with cross-functional partners (Practice Operations, Growth, Clinical, IT) to ensure applications are launch-ready and staff are trained
